摘要
In this work, we report the preparation of Al2O3/V2O5 nanocomposit using vanadium and aluminum nitrate by sol-gel method. Characterization of nanocomposit was carried out by powder X-ray diffractometry (XRD), Fourier transform infrared (FT-IR), scanning electron microscopy (SEM), Energy-Dispersive X-ray (EDX) and UV spectroscopy. Then, applicability of the synthesized nanocomposit was tested as a nanocatalyst for the synthesis of diindolyl oxindole derivatives, an important class of potentially bioactive compounds. The products were obtained in good to high yields from one-pot three-component condensation of isatin with indole. Also, this nanocatalyst has been reused several times, without observable loss of activity.
